What is a Psychiatric Evaluation?
A psychiatric evaluation is a thorough assessment targeted at diagnosing mental health conditions and understanding a person's frame of mind. It often includes interviews, questionnaires, and observational assessments to gather extensive info about the client's psychological, mental, and social functioning.
Secret Objectives of a Psychiatric EvaluationDiagnosis: Identify mental health conditions like anxiety, anxiety, schizophrenia, and so on.Treatment Planning: Develop a customized treatment strategy based upon the evaluation results.Baseline Measurement: Establish a baseline to keep track of development over time.Risk Assessment: Evaluate the risk of self-harm or damage to others.Referral: Determine whether more examination or additional services are required.The Process of a Psychiatric Evaluation

An extensive psychiatric evaluation generally consists of the following components:

Clinical Interview: This acts as the structure of the evaluation, where the mental health professional gathers detailed information about the patient's history and current experiences.

Mental Status Examination (MSE): This assessment tests different elements of a patient's mental state consisting of appearance, habits, state of mind, believed processes, and understandings.

Danger Assessment: Evaluators gauge the client's danger level for self-harm or damage to others based on their disclosures and behaviors.

Physical Examination: Sometimes a physical exam or lab tests can assist rule out medical issues adding to psychiatric signs.

Diagnostic Criteria: The mental health expert uses the DSM-5 (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ders, Fifth Edition) or ICD-10/ ICD-11 for precise diagnosis.
